| bowdidge's Full Review: Sony Cyber-Shot DSC-U30 Digital Camera |
The Sony DSC-U30 is my travel camera. It may not give me as much control over my images, or give me 4 megapixel images, but I can't imagine going anywhere without it.
The biggest advantage is size. The camera will fit in my jeans pocket, or I can carry it around my neck. It doesn't look like a camera, so I don't feel like a tourist. With my larger camera (an Olympus C-4040), I'll keep it in a knapsack out of sight; the Sony's always ready, and I'm willing to carry it everywhere. I carried this camera around Hong Kong and Singapore for two weeks; all my fun spontaneous shots were with this camera -- buddhist monks under an umbrella, surprise photos of my wife and I walking down the street, strange signs, or street scenes. I've also been surprised how often I'll hold it at arm's length and get a photo of us; its mirror ensures I actually get the photograph.
On all my travels, it'll survive a full day on a single charge of batteries; a 256MB memory stick easily held 14 days of photos.
There's times I still love the big, high-quality camera... but this is the one I'll reach for as I'm heading out the door.
